About Museum Fine Arts of Rouen

The Rouen Museum of Fine Arts (Musée des Beaux-Arts de Rouen) is located in the heart of the historic center of Rouen, in Normandy, France. It is considered one of the most important museums in France outside of Paris, with a collection of over 8,000 works of art spanning from the Renaissance to the 21st century. The museum's collection includes works by major European artists such as Caravaggio, Rubens, Delacroix, and Monet, as well as a significant collection of works by local artists from Normandy. The museum is housed in a 19th-century building that was extensively renovated and expanded in the early 21st century. In addition to its permanent collection, the museum also hosts temporary exhibitions throughout the year. The museum's collection is organized around several themes, including European painting from the 16th to the 20th century, French painting from the 19th century, and sculpture from the 16th to the 20th century. The museum also has a significant collection of ceramics and decorative arts, including examples from the famous Rouen pottery tradition.
